Iowa football coach Kirk Ferentz says quarterback Mark Gronowski will not take part in spring drills but is set to begin throwing. Gronowski transferred to Iowa after a standout career at South Dakota State and underwent surgery on his throwing shoulder.

Gronowski is part of a quarterback room that includes Brendan Sullivan, Jackson Stratton and Auburn transfer Hank Brown.
Ferentz likes the depth at quarterback heading into next season.
The Hawkeyes finished 8-5 last season which included a loss to Missouri in the Music City Bowl.
